Javier Licandro is an academic researcher from Spanish National Research Council. The author has contributed to research in topics: Asteroid & Comet. The author has an hindex of 49, co-authored 305 publications receiving 8194 citations. Previous affiliations of Javier Licandro include IAC & University of Central Florida.
